Kenyan entertainer Joseph Mwenda, popularly known as DJ Joe Mfalme, has addressed rumors circulating on-air alleging that he betrayed his friend Allan Ochieng, also known as Hype Ballo, in connection with the murder case of senior detective Felix Kelian.
In an exclusive interview with Milele FM’s Ankali Ray, DJ Joe Mfalme clarified the situation, affirming that he and Hype Ballo maintain a good relationship despite the public speculation surrounding their friendship.
“People don’t know the full story, and since the matter is currently in court, I prefer not to comment on it. Public opinion is inevitable, but I want to make it clear that Hype Ballo and I are still in good terms. However, due to the ongoing investigations, we are not allowed to discuss the case,” DJ Joe Mfalme stated.
Additionally, DJ Joe Mfalme dismissed rumors suggesting that his friends had abandoned him during his time in custody, stating that he received significant support from both friends and family. He expressed gratitude for their unwavering support during a challenging period.
Furthermore, DJ Joe Mfalme revealed his plans to resume his normal work schedule now that he has been released. This statement indicates his readiness to move forward positively and continue pursuing his career in the entertainment industry.
